Analyzing Democratic Politicians' Responses to AIPAC Scrutiny and Massachusetts Primary Political Maneuvering

Understand how high-profile Democrats like Josh Shapiro deflect pointed questions about lobbying influence, and analyze the high-stakes political calculus behind Seth Molton’s decision to reject AIPAC funding.

Short Summary

  • Analyze Josh Shapiro’s defense strategy, which reframed questions about AIPAC as "lazy" shortcuts rather than substantive policy inquiries.
  • Contrast Shapiro’s deflection with Seth Molton's direct rejection of AIPAC funding, noting Molton's specific criticism centers on reflexive support for the Netanyahu government.
  • Review how other potential contenders (Newsom, Booker) similarly mishandled scrutiny regarding foreign policy positions when pressed by interviewers.

This segment examines recent political confrontations centered on AIPAC donations and influence, primarily focusing on Pennsylvania Governor Josh Shapiro's interview tactics and the contrasting stance of Massachusetts Senate candidate Seth Molton. The discussion provides insight into how establishment Democrats navigate contentious foreign policy questions while also examining internal party dynamics regarding cultural issues and long-serving incumbents.
